Free bodyweight workout plans here. Most of the stuff, you can do in the house. I also downloaded the Tabata timer app for my own personal training. It's free and it's easy to program. You input the number of exercises (stations) that you want to do; the time for each drill, the rest time in between; and how many sets you want to do. Then the phone does all the work and you don't need to be fluting around with a stopwatch or handling your mobile. Just leave it somewhere within your view and earshot. Working against the clock suits me better. When I'm starting to tire but I see there's 15 seconds or whatever left on the clock, it pushes me to keep doing and squeeze another few reps in instead of giving up.
